Miracle of Light

At the beginning of Shabbat, Rabbi Hanina ben Dosa saw that his daughter was upset.   He asked her what was wrong and she answered that she accidently used vinegar instead of oil to light the Shabbat candles.    God, who told them should burn only oil, can also declare that vinegar can also burn.    As it turned out the candles miraculously burned until it was time for Havdalah.   – Taanit 25 a What might have happened did not.   W hat might have happened?   T he poor daughter could have been chastised, berated, made to feel small. Moral? It is easy to judge but better to forgive.

Uplift

Two people came [to the marketplace]. [Eliyahu HaNavi] said to [Rabbi Broka]: Those people are destined for the World to Come. [Rabbi Broka] went to them and said: What is your profession? They said: we are comedians who entertain those who are sad. Ta’anit 22a

For Jerusalem

Talmud teaches us:  “Anyone who mourns for Jerusalem will merit the privilege of sharing in her joy, and any one who does not mourn for her will not merit that privilege.”   -Taanit 30b

Prayer

We have been taught: “To love the Lord your God and to serve Him with all your heart" (Deuteronomy 11:13). What service (Avodah) is that with the heart? It is prayer. - Ta’anit 2 a
